How many GPIB interfaces can I configure for use with my GPIB
software?
You can configure the GPIB software for Windows to communicate
with up to 100 GPIB interfaces.
How many devices can I configure for use with my GPIB software?
The GPIB software for Windows provides a total of 1,024 logical
devices for applications to use. The default number of devices is 32.
The maximum number of physical devices you should connect to a
single GPIB interface is 14, or fewer depending on your system
configuration.
Are interrupts and DMA required for the GPIB software ?
Neither interrupts nor DMA are required.
How can I determine if my GPIB hardware and software are
installed properly?
Run the Diagnostic utility: select the Diagnostic item under Start»
Programs»National Instruments GPIB. Refer to the
section in this appendix or the online help
to troubleshoot any problems.
